The Best VPN Software for Windows

What is the best VPN for Windows? It’s completely legitimate to ask this question, as not all VPN for Windows are the same in terms of speed, security, privacy, and ability to unblock Netflix and allow torrenting. 

To help you out, I’ve vigorously tested the best to be able to deliver you the review of the top 5 best VPN for Windows.

I have also delivered you a detailed overview of the best VPN services for Mac in case you or your friends use another operating system.


nordvpn windows

Pricing & plans: 1-month – $12.95, 6-months – $59.95, 1-year – $99.95 [+3 free months]

Compatibility: Windows 10, Android, iOS, macOS, Chrome, Firefox, Android TV, routers

Number of servers: 5,600+

Server locations: 60+

IP Addresses: N/A

Maximum devices supported: 6

Pros & Cons:

+ External audit of privacy claims

+Kill Switch

+ Convenient live chat support

+ Unblocks Netflix

Somewhat more expensive than the competition

Lack of some browser extensions

NordVPN is often found on the lists of best VPN service providers. It has a spotless history in providing VPN services. As a company under Panama’s jurisdiction, it assures clients that their data will always remain beyond the reach of any government.

NordVPN can easily be the fastest VPN for PC as it delivers ultra-fast internet speeds in both download and upload categories. The company has a strict no-logging policy and doesn’t track record or store user browsing history. NordVPN upholds very tight security. 

DoubleVPN feature routes user data through 2 VPN servers, ensuring complete security. The security protocols include IKEv2/IPsec, OpenVPN, PPTP, and L2TP. 

NordVPN is P2P friendly meaning its users can effortlessly enjoy torrenting without risking their private data will get out there. During the IP and DNS leak test, I didn’t identify any leaks. 

Unblocking Netflix geo-restrictions with VPN is straightforward. Windows 10 client is optimized and designed with ease of use in mind. 

Download NordVPN Read Review


expressvpn for windows

Pricing & plans: 1-month $12.95, 6-months $59.95, 1-year $99.95 [+3 free months]

Compatibility: Windows 10, Android, iOS, macOS, browser extensions, routers

Number of servers: 3,000+

Server locations: 160

IP Addresses: 30,000+

Maximum devices supported: 5

Pros & Cons:

+ Great customer support

+ Good compatibility

+ A large network of VPN servers

+ Consistent performance across the network

Somewhat expensive

Can’t use browser extensions without ExpressVPN app

ExpressVPN is based in the British Virgin Islands and offers top-notch VPN services to its clients. The extensive geo coverage ensures good connectivity. No wonder it made onto our list of best free VPNs.

Fast authentication and outstanding performance across the ExpressVPN network are a result of years-long development plans and investments, thus somewhat more expensive subscription plans.

ExpressVPN has a zero-logging policy and features several different security protocols: OpenVPN/ UDP, OpenVPN TCP, L2TP – IPSec, PPTP, and IKEv2. The 256-bit AES encryption makes communication between clients and servers virtually unhackable. 

ExpressVPN is P2P-friendly, but the company likes to keep things quiet. There is no data-cap nor connection-throttling. Users can enjoy torrenting across the entire Express VPN network. 

I’ve been able to bypass Netflix geo-restrictions on every single server I connected to, which is quite a rare thing to see in a VPN service provider.

Download ExpressVPN Read Review

Related post: How to setup a VPN for Windows.


cyberghost for windows

Pricing & plans: 1-month $12.99, 1-year $71.88, 3-years $99 [+2 months free]

Compatibility: Windows 10, macOS, Android, iOS, Linux, Amazon Firestick, Android TV, Routers

Number of servers: 3,700+

Server locations: 60+

IP Addresses: N/A

Maximum devices supported: 7

Pros & Cons:

+ Free trial

+ Easy to use client

+ Good geo coverage

+ Great value in 3-years plan

Inconsistent speed across the network

Setting up OpenVPN takes skill

CyberGhost is a Romania and Germany-based VPN service provider offering access to a large server network strategically placed all over the globe. It’s Windows client is particularly easy to use, but still boasting advanced features tech-savvy audience will more than welcome. 

The speed test results were satisfying over the short-distance connections. On long-distance connections, speed is inconsistent. Still, it is well above the industry average. CyberGhost has a zero-log policy to ensure its customer’s safety and security. No DNS or IP leaks were detected during testing. 

When it comes to security protocols and encryption, I’ve found all the usual suspects, including 256-bit AES encryption, and OpenVPN, IKEv2, and L2TP/IPSec protocols. 

CyberGhost supports torrenting, but I’ve found out that it is not allowed on all servers. When it comes to unblocking Netflix, CyberGhost offers an easy way to do it. The CyberGhost Windows client highlights the servers that are recommended for unblocking Netflix in your geo region. 

Download Cyberghost Read Review


tunnelbear for windows

Pricing & plans: 1-month – $4.99 Unlimited, 1-month $5.75 Teams 2+ users 

Compatibility: macOS, Windows 10, iOS, Android

Number of servers: N/A

Server locations: 22

IP Addresses: N/A

Maximum devices supported: 5

Pros & Cons:

+ Zero-logging policy

+ 500 Mb free plan

+ Easy to use Windows client

+ Security audited by 3d party

Limited network coverage

Can’t unblock Netflix

TunnelBear is owned by McAfee and based in Canada. The company is trying to appeal to people who are interested in protecting their anonymity and enhancing their security online.

It can not be said the same for tech-savvy people. I couldn’t uncover any technical information about TunnelBear VPN whatsoever. 

They have tight security and encryption protocols, as confirmed by an independent company that runs annual security audits for TunnelBear. I tested TunnelBear for IP and DNS leaks, and no leaks were detected.

TunnelBear is not as fast as some other VPN service providers. It delivers average speeds, but what I found satisfying is the speed consistency across the entire network. TunnelBear is torrent-friendly and seems to have optimized its servers, which means that this VPN supports fast torrent download and upload speeds.

I wasn’t able to unblock Netflix with it, though. No matter how hard I tried and changed servers, Netflix geo-restrictions would not budge. 

Download TunnelbearRead Review


sufrshark for windows

Pricing & plans: 1-month $11.95, 12-months $71.88, 27-months $47.76

Compatibility: Windows 10, macOS, iOS, Android, Linux

Number of servers: 800+

Server locations: 50+

IP Addresses: N/A

Maximum devices supported: No limit

Pros & Cons:

+ No limit on simultaneous connections

+ Unblocks Netflix

+ Great value with 27-months plan

+ Excellent customer support

The free trial is reserved for Mac and mobile users

Vague privacy policy

Surfshark is based in the British Virgin Islands, which allows it to deliver its zero-logging promise legally. While Surfshark runs a large operation and has servers in over 50 countries, it delivered speeds above the industry average. 

With its private DNS server, 256-bit AES encryption and OpenVPN UDP and TCP, and IKEv2 security protocols, Surfshark delivers top-notch security to its users. Also, I didn’t detect IP or DNS leaks during testing.

Surfshark is P2P friendly and delivers ultra-fast torrenting speeds. With access to kill Switch, users can enjoy safe and secure torrenting. 

Surfshark is one of the best VPN for Windows to use if you love to stream Netflix shows and movies. It bypasses Netflix geo-restrictions without breaking a sweat and unlocks large 16 Netflix libraries. 

Download Surfshark

Is VPN safe to use?

VPN is safe to use. There are no legal restrictions that apply to their use case. Besides, all the best VPN for Windows, I’ve listed above, feature state-of-the-art security protocols and encryption to keep you safe while browsing and enjoying your favorite content online.

Does Windows 10 have a built-in VPN?

Windows 10 features a built-in VPN client, which serves as another security layer for Windows 10 users. Thanks to this feature, Windows 10 has become a more secure platform to work on. A built-in VPN client allows Windows users to access public servers through a private route. 

Is VPN worth it?

VPN is definitely worth paying for. VPN providers that offer free VPN services will often optimize bandwidth and speed to accommodate paying customers’ needs better and at the cost of those that use services for free. 

There also some companies that offer free VPN services but meanwhile collect users’ browsing history, such as Facebook’s free VPN service called Onavo.